引言
比特币作为一种数字货币,在过去的十余年里取得了蓬勃发展。比特币的安全性与私钥管理息息相关,这就引出了HD(Hierarchical Deterministic)钱包的概念。HD钱包以其高效的私钥生成和安全的管理方式受到越来越多用户的青睐。在本文中,我们将深入探讨比特币HD钱包的私钥,分析其工作原理、安全性,以及如何有效管理与保护这些私钥。
什么是HD钱包?
HD钱包,即层级确定性钱包,是一种使用种子生成私钥的加密货币钱包。与传统钱包不同,HD钱包可以从一个主私钥导出多于一个的子私钥,这意味着用户只需记住一个种子,就可以重建其所有的子钱包。HD钱包遵循BIP32(Bitcoin Improvement Proposal 32)的标准,这使其能够生成无数的私钥,同时确保只需一个种子即可恢复。
HD钱包的结构使得它提高了用户的私钥管理效率。用户可以便捷地进行交易,同时又不必担心遗忘或丢失私钥。每个子钱包的地址都是使用其父私钥生成的,这种层级结构大大简化了密钥管理的复杂性。
HD钱包中的私钥生成
HD钱包的私钥生成过程十分复杂,并涉及多个步骤。首先,用户需要生成一个随机种子(通常为128-256位的随机数),这个种子将作为新钱包的主私钥。随后,借助数学算法,钱包将这个种子输入至BIP32引导的算法中,进而生成一系列的私钥和公钥。
每个私钥与其对应的公钥被组织成一棵树结构,用户可以在此树的任意位置生成子私钥。这一架构的优点在于,用户只需记录下初始的种子,如果将来需要恢复钱包,可以通过种子还原出所有的私钥。值得注意的是,种子本身也需妥善保管,一旦被泄露,攻击者即可完全控制HD钱包的所有资产。
私钥的安全性与风险
尽管HD钱包在私钥生成和管理上有诸多优势,但它们的安全性依然面临各种威胁。首先,最常见的风险来自于设备本身的安全性。如果一台设备被木马程序感染,恶意软件可能窃取用户的种子和私钥。此外,网络钓鱼也是用户面临的重要威胁,攻击者可能伪装成合法网站诱导用户输入其私钥或种子。
为了提高HD钱包的安全性,用户可以采取以下几种措施:
- 使用硬件钱包:硬件钱包提供了更高的安全性。私钥存储在物理设备中,不会暴露在电脑或手机等网络设备中。
- 多重签名:使用多重签名技术,要求多个私钥共同授权才能完成交易,这样即使某个私钥被盗,攻击者也无法轻易获取资金。
- 定期备份:定期备份钱包的种子和私钥,并将备份存储在安全的地方,可以有效防止丢失资产。
如何有效管理HD钱包的私钥
管理HD钱包的私钥需求用户高度的重视。首先,用户应该选择一个值得信赖的钱包提供商,并了解其安全措施。此外,建议用户定期更换私钥与地址,减少被潜在攻击者追踪的风险。对比特币用户而言,将对其个体隐私和交易安全负责并做好记录是极为重要的。
在使用HD钱包的过程中,用户还应该关注当前的钱包软件版本,及时升级至最新版本,以确保自身安全性。此外,用户还应当设定合适的访问权限及使用限制,例如禁止公共Wi-Fi环境下进行交易,以防止安全隐患。
HD钱包与传统钱包的对比
传统钱包是最初的一种数字钱包形式,其私钥的生成和管理通常较为简单。其相对HD钱包而言,传统钱包的私钥仅有一组固定的密钥。这意味着如果用户丢失了私钥,则将无法恢复钱包中的资产。这种单一性带来的风险增加了用户的负担,用户一旦丢失私钥,将不得不承受全部的损失。
与之相比,HD钱包的优势在于其能够生成无限个私钥,让用户避免因丢失单个私钥而面临失去所有资产的风险。用户只需妥善保管主种子,便可以恢复整个钱包的私钥,并继续使用。这种分层的设计不仅提升了数字资产的安全性,也在一定程度上简化了用户的管理流程,为用户提供了更为灵活的使用体验。
同时,传统钱包的地址管理通常采用固定的地址模式,而HD钱包则通过动态地址生成,大幅提升了用户的隐私保护。因此,对于用户而言,使用HD钱包无论在安全性、灵活性,还是隐私保护上都有着不可替代的优势。
HD钱包的种子管理与恢复过程
在HD钱包中,种子的管理与恢复过程是至关重要的。用户在初次创建钱包时,会获得一个助记词或者种子,通常由12到24个单词组成。这个助记词是生成私钥的关键,在恢复或重建钱包时起着决定性的作用。
若用户需要恢复钱包,只需在适当的位置进入助记词,它将被输入至HD钱包软件中。软件会根据这些单词重建出用户的所有密钥和地址。这一过程应确保在安全的环境中进行,避免在公共场合或不安全的设备上操作,以降低账号遭到黑客攻击的风险。
鉴于助记词的重要性,用户应采取以下措施增强种子的安全性:
- 书写备份:将助记词手动书写并保存在安全的环境中,避免使用电子方式存储,防止被黑客获取。
- 使用保险箱或硬件钱包:将其储存在保险箱中或使用专用硬件钱包加以保护,这将提供额外的安全保障。
- 设置安全问题或密码:为了增加恢复过程的安全性,建议用户设定安全问题或密码保护,以此防止敌对攻击者的进入。
用户应当牢记,种子的管理是整个钱包安全控制的关键,任何泄露都有可能导致资产的失窃。因此,切勿轻易分享种子信息或助记词,而应当保持高度的谨慎和警觉。
在HD钱包中进行交易的注意事项
在HD钱包中进行交易时,用户仍需保持警觉,并采取必要的安全预防措施。确认交易地址的准确性是交易中最重要的一步。用户在输入交易地址时,应使用复制粘贴的方式,而避免手动输入,因为手动输入可能导致地址的错误,从而使资产发送至错误的地址。
此外,用户还应定期检查钱包中的余额和交易记录,留意异常活动,及时发现可能的安全隐患。如果发现任何可疑交易,用户应立即更改钱包的地址、私钥,并准备使用备份种子恢复钱包。
另一个不可忽视的事项是,永远不要在不安全的网络上进行交易。例如,应避免在公共Wi-Fi或未加密的网络环境中访问HD钱包。在这种情况下,黑客可能会通过中间人攻击窃取用户的数据,从而威胁到用户的资金安全。
总体而言,尽管HD钱包带来了更为高效的私钥管理和安全性,但用户依然需保持警惕,并遵循最佳的实践,确保自己的资产安全。
总结
在比特币的世界中,私钥的安全管理至关重要。HD钱包凭借其层级结构的优势,提供了更为高效的管理方案。绕开传统钱包的劣势,HD钱包不仅降低了私钥丢失的风险,还提升了用户隐私保护的能力。然而,用户仍需对私钥和助记词的管理保持高度重视,通过使用硬件钱包、多重签名等策略,进一步巩固资产安全。因此只有理解与掌握了HD钱包的私钥管控,用户才能在逐渐成熟的数字货币世界中自信地站稳脚跟。